A companyโs cash on hand also refered as cash/cash equivalents (CCE) and Short-term investments, is the amount of accessible money a business has.
Year | Cash on Hand | Change |
---|---|---|
2022-12-31 | $2.96 B | -12.11% |
2021-12-31 | $3.37 B | 27.66% |
2020-12-31 | $2.64 B | 21.31% |
2019-12-31 | $2.17 B | -32.21% |
2018-12-31 | $3.21 B | 8.79% |
2017-12-31 | $2.95 B | 12.57% |
2016-12-31 | $2.62 B | 2.07% |
2015-12-31 | $2.57 B | 79.83% |
2014-12-31 | $1.42 B | -42.6% |
2013-12-31 | $2.49 B | 42.76% |
2012-12-31 | $1.74 B | -5.39% |
2011-12-31 | $1.84 B | 21.71% |
2010-12-31 | $1.51 B | -0.04% |
2009-12-31 | $1.51 B | 29.01% |
2008-12-31 | $1.17 B | 28.42% |
2007-12-31 | $0.91 B | 50.7% |
2006-12-31 | $0.60 B | 35.33% |
2005-12-31 | $0.44 B | -40.14% |
2004-12-31 | $0.74 B | 35.62% |
2003-12-31 | $0.55 B | 33.35% |
2002-12-31 | $0.41 B | 5.11% |
2001-12-31 | $0.39 B |
